Painting practice! I want to get better at putting characters in environments, so I redrew a photo of an alpine lake. And then put Olympea in so it would qualify as Kirby art HSHSK
Maybe she got somehow transported there? Idk. Maybe I'll draw someone on a volcano next and say it's Halcandra. Or flying above the clouds.
I like painting like this. It's rough but also 5 thousand times faster than sketching and lining and flat colours. Probably because I'm not agonising about every stroke and only worrying about shapes. Shapes instead of lines works much better when you're trying to capture an environment.
I've always wanted to do those aerial paintings but I can never get the perspective right without just copying a photo and I want to get better at that. Like yeah, I do draw it freehand, but I want to be able to make up my own scene altogether and only need the reference for things like how to draw the twilight atmosphere or fluffiness of the clouds themselves, or how to do things like spread vegetation out naturally or draw a convincing rock. But to do that I'd first have to study the effect things like twilight have on the perceived colour of the environment and familiarise myself with the essence of clouds and plant life and rocks until I can properly conceptualise them in my mind. So reference photo it is, for now.
That's another thing I'd like to get better at. Lighting conditions. I can eyeball colours and draw a character in neutral lighting perfectly well. And have a...decent grasp of shadows. But the second weird lighting hits the scene? I'm lost. But I think if I can break out of the neutral colours, 'vaguely lit from above in front' safe zone, I could really bring my art to the next level.
